Note: According to a newspaper report Daniel Vick died following a work accident while unloading a boat at…

According to a newspaper report Daniel Vick died following a work accident while unloading a boat at the Gloucester docks and an inquest recorded it as accidental. He was a baker so it is unusual that he was doing such work. I don't have his death certificate but I can't find him elsewhere afterwards, the age is correct and he was buried in Elmore, the parish of his grandparents and location of his father's burial.
